Hi, Rick.

Welcome to ATP.

One way to earn acorns here is to add information and pictures to our collective plant database. The link to it is top left on almost any page of ATP. To make an addition simply type the name of the plant in the search box on the main database page, make your selection from the choices given and follow the prompts. Feel free to experiment with it, nothing will be saved until you click on "submit". Once you've made a submission a moderator will review it. Once it's been reviewed and posted you'll be notified by an automatic system message. It's fun and easy to do, and your input will help others learn about plants of interest.

Galleries are photo sections of the DB; like bloom images, leaf images, seed images, etc.

Rick...you can add several pictures of the same plant...if you add more then one pic of the bloom you get one acorn. However, if you add a pic of the leaves you get another acorn...pic of stem=another acorn...pic of seed pod=another acorn and so on down the list. So bottom line for the same plant you can earn more then just one acorn Smiling
